Mary's Flame of Love and the Ave Maria!


In Elizabeth Kindlemann's spiritual diaries, our Blessed Mother reveals how she would like us to pray the "Ave Maria" (a.k.a. the "Hail Mary")..

Our Holy Mother would like us to honor the Flame of Love when saying the "Hail Mary" by saying it in the following way:

"Hail Mary, full of grace, the Lord is with thee;
Blessed are you among women,
And blessed is the fruit of thy womb, Jesus.

Holy Mary, Mother of God, Pray for us, sinners, 
Spread the effect of grace of thy flame of love,
over all humanitynow and at the hour of our death.  
Amen."

From what I am understanding reading this information on the official Flame of Love Movement website, we are to say the "Hail Mary" like this even when reciting our rosaries from this point on.  When we do recite the Ave Maria in this manner, we will be able to deliver souls from Purgatory by our prayer.  In fact, the Holy Virgin promised Elizabeth Kindlemann the following:  

“Whoever prays three Hail Mary in honor of My Flame of Love delivers a soul from Purgatory. Whoever prays one Hail Mary in honor of My Flame of Love during the month of November, delivers 10 souls from Purgatory.”

Our Blessed Mother goes on to promise that those souls who will be delivered from Purgatory by our prayers will help us in saving souls from heaven.

Catholic Tidbit: Remembering Forgotten Souls


Other than knowing this is "a state of purification", purgatory is something I feel I know or understand very little about.  However I did learn a few new tidbits about it recently that I'd like to share.

I was listening to a tv show one day about purgatory and two things said there stuck with me.  One, once there we cannot pray ourselves OUT of purgatory.  Meaning our time on earth is the only time we have to make choices and decisions, receive indulgences, and pray for ourselves and others that will directly affect our time in purgatory (for the better or worse). Two, there are so many souls in purgatory and many of which are forgotten or abandoned, as they are not prayed for because many do not believe in purgatory.  Then it hit me, “How LONG must it take to get out of purgatory once you are there if you have NO ONE praying for you?!”.  Did you also know that we receive special graces when we help pray for those in purgatory?  Although, souls in purgatory cannot pray for themselves they can and will pray for us out of gratitude for our prayers for them.  If we pray for someone that is no longer in purgatory but has entered the kingdom of God we also receive a special grace!  AMAZING, right?!  For these reasons we, crazy Catholics, have an ENTIRE MONTH where we celebrate and remember those souls who have passed from this world.  November is the time to celebrate the saints and remember the souls.

Let us say the prayer revealed to St. Gertrude the Great by the Lord who promised that 1000 souls would be released from purgatory every time the prayer below is said sincerely:


Eternal Father, I offer Thee the Most Precious Blood of Thy Divine Son, Jesus, in union with the masses said throughout the world today, for all the holy souls in purgatory, for sinners everywhere, for sinners in the universal church, those in my own home and within my family. Amen.
